Clients and Contacts are a crucial part of your account. Clients are going to be who you actually do the work for- the projects will be assigned out to clients. Contacts will be the individuals associated with each client. Below you'll learn

How to Create a Client

Go to the Clients tab and click create new client. Fill in the details on the new client page including Name, Description, Location, Website, Assignees, Priority Level and Services and click create client when you're all set or click create and add another. You'll also see the capability here to mark a client as active or inactive.

How to Create a Contact

Go to the Contacts tab and click Create new contact. Fill in the details on the New Contact page and click create contact when you're all set or click create and add another.

How to Associate a Contact with a Client

Go to the Clients tab and select the client you want to associate a contact with. Once on the client profile, click add contact and you can either create a new contact or select an existing contact from the dropdown menu to associate it with the client.

How to Designate a Primary Contact

If you only have one contact associated with a client, they will automatically be marked as the primary contact. If you have multiple, you can select which contact you would like to be listed as the primary. Contacts will be visible on the client profile. You will also be able to see all the clients a contact is associated with from the contacts tab!

FAQs

Can a Client have more than one Contact associated with them?

Yes, a client can have more than one contact associated. You will be able to see this on the Clients tab if both clients are on the same page.

Can a Contact be listed as a Primary Contact for more than one Client?

Yes, a contact can be the Primary Contact for more than one client. This can be seen on the contact's profile page. If a client has more than one contact associated, click the "…" next to a different contact to make it the Primary Contact for the client.
